Not necessarily. The banks are required to implement it and provide it as a service. The real win of the system is actually how good it is, and how in some instances it's better than using cards.
These days, whenever I'm there, I favour Pix over cards whenever I can. To me personally, it's not only more convenient in some cases (and the only option in others) but it's also a way of avoiding sending data and money to the likes of Visa and MasterCard.
Argentina has adopted the system to attract Brazilian tourists as well, which means as a Brazilian you can get away with a lot there even if you don't have an international card.